Assiminea nitida Abbott, 1949 |
| No Picture Available |
| Family: | Assimineidae () | |||
| Max. size: | ||||
| Environment: | benthic; freshwater; brackish; marine | |||
| Distribution: | Pacific Ocean. | |||
| Diagnosis: | ||||
| Biology: | Living on rocks wetted by freshwater near the coasts of Sunday and Dayrell islands; dead shells occasionally dredged off the shore (Ref. 88739). Also found in mangrove areas (Ref. 129120). | |||
